What is the VAT Annual Statement Form?
The VAT Annual Statement Form is a critical document for registered persons in India, used to report their annual sales and purchase details for Value Added Tax (VAT) purposes. This form collects essential information including gross sales, tax-free sales, purchases, and prior period adjustments. The deadline for filing the VAT Annual Statement is set for the 20th of August of the following year, underscoring its significance for compliance with tax regulations.

Who needs to file the VAT Annual Statement Form?
Registered persons in India who have made taxable sales and purchases must file the VAT Annual Statement Form annually to report their VAT obligations.
What is the filing deadline for the VAT Annual Statement Form?
The VAT Annual Statement Form must be filed by August 20th of the year following the reporting period, ensuring compliance with local tax regulations.
What information is required to complete this form?
You will need details such as gross sales, tax-free sales, returns, discounts, net taxable sales, and purchases to complete the VAT Annual Statement Form accurately.

Is notarization required for the VAT Annual Statement Form?
No, notarization is not required for the VAT Annual Statement Form. However, the registered person must sign the declaration included in the form.
